Job Duties/Responsibilities A Library Aide provides assistance to students and teachers in a school

library media center and performs clerical and computer-related duties to

support library functions.

TYPICAL DUTIES

  • Assists in the overall school library functions by maintaining catalogs,

lists, and records in the District’s centralized computerized library
system; processing, circulating, and shelving books and various learning

materials; stamping, labeling, mending, and cleaning library books and

other learning resources; and performing regular inventories.

  • Provides guidance and assistance to students in the selection of books

and in using other library resources.

  • Adds library copies into a database utilizing the District’s central
computerized library system and generates related reports including

statistics reports and patron data.

  • Provides assistance to teachers in the instruction of information

retrieval skills using the District’s centralized computerized library
system.

  • Presents educational information to students under the supervision of

the librarian or a qualified classroom teacher.

  • Provides assistance to students in accessing research materials to

support units of study.

  • Assists parents with accessing library services for students.
  • Assists visiting certificated teachers in the supervision of students

visiting the library media center and review the work of student helpers or

service students.

  • Assists the Teacher Librarian or Coordinating Field Librarian in the

selection and ordering of library materials.

  • Helps maintain an orderly and functional room environment conducive

to learning.

  • May assists in coordinating events such as book fairs and planning

activities that encourage and motivate students to read.

  • May read-aloud and provide book talks to groups of students.
  • Performs related duties as assigned.

Minimum Requirements EDUCATION:

In compliance with the Every Student Succeeds Act (ESSA) of 2015 and

other related legislation, candidates for this classification must meet the

following standards:

Paraprofessionals who provide instructional assistance are required to

pass the District Proficiency Test and possess a high school diploma or

equivalent and one of the following:

  • Completion of 48 semester units or 72 quarter units from a recognized

college or university;

OR

  • Possession of an associate or higher degree, from a recognized college

or university;

OR

  • Receipt of a passing score on the Instructional Assistance Test.

EXPERIENCE:

Six months of clerical or library experience, including use of a

computerized library system is preferable.

Desirable Qualifications The ideal candidate would possess experience working with children in a

school, community organization, daycare, or other professional

environment; a familiarity with common computer systems such as

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Outlook, etc.) and the Internet; prior

experience tracking and maintaining a large volume of records/files;

college coursework in the areas of Education, Library Science, Child

Development, Psychology, and/or Sociology; and experience working in

a library setting.

Additional Posting Information Selection and promotion are based on a competitive employment

assessment process. Candidates who pass all parts of the assessment

process are placed on a hiring (eligibility) list based on their assessment

score. Hiring departments may make job offers to candidates on the top

three ranks of the hiring list. Eligibility typically lasts for 12 months. The

hiring list resulting from this assessment process may be used to fill open

positions in related job classifications.
